Mental Health in Richboro, PA - What is Mental Health
The definition of mental health is the condition of our emotional, cognitive, and behavioral state. In short, our mental health is our mental state. It can impact everything from our thoughts and feelings, to our actions and stimulus responses.
Our mental health can have a great impact on our overall quality of life, affecting daily activities and relationships at work, at home, and in our love lives. It contributes to our self-esteem, influences how we make choices, our ability to communicate, and even our ability to learn.
Even though we cannot actually see or measure it, our mental health directly relates to how we interact with the world around us. How our minds operate, ultimately controls who we are as individuals.

Paying for Richboro Mental Health Rehab
Nothing in life is free, and mental healthcare is no exception. The cost of housing, medication, therapy, and all other aspects of recovery can add up. Someone has to pay them. In the United States, the most common method of paying for any type of health care is insurance. However, this isn’t the only option. Additional payment options include government-funded or subsidized health insurance, self-pay, scholarships, and free programs:
- Private Insurance may be available through your employer or your spouse/parent’s employer. Private insurance can also be purchased directly from the insurance provider.
- Subsidized Private Insurance is available through the Healthcare Marketplace to people who earn less than a certain income, yet are not eligible for medicare/medicaid.
- Medicare - A government-funded healthcare option available to individuals over the age of 65.
- Medicaid - A government-funded healthcare option available to low-income individuals and families.Medicare/Medicaid- Government-funded healthcare options for those below a certain income or over the age of 65.
- Cash Pay] - Those who have the financial means may pay for their mental health treatment Richboro out-of-pocket. Payment plans and credit options may be available for self-pay clients.
- Scholarships - Occasionally, mental health rehab programs Richboro offer a scholarship for individuals who display a great desire and dedication to healing, but otherwise would not have the financial means] to pay for [the treatment they need.
- “Free” Programs - Private and public not-for-profit organizations allocate funds to provide mental health services to lower income individuals in their community. However, it is common to see a long waitlist in areas with a greater need for these services.
